5 Pet Food Facts

Most often pets fall sick when their diets don't do enough to optimise their health. Commercial pet foods rarely, if ever, supply the essential supplements and vitamins that counteract diseases.


Fact 1 - There are currently no regulations in Australia for the Pet Food Industry. Only 70% of Pet Food Business's are current members of the PFIAA (Pet Food Industry Association of Australia). These members respond to incidents enquiries where non-members do not.

Fact 2 - Cat and Dog food is mostly Grain.

Most manufactured pet food is still 65% grains, grain fillers, fibers and grain byproducts. Corn based ingredients and simple carbohydrates translate to sugar. It is sugar that causes chronic inflammation, obesity and cognitive issues. Dogs and cats need Protein, healthy fats and nutrient rich ingredients for optimal health, where the commercial pet food forsakes these staples in favour of simple carbohydrates which are cheaper to produce.

Fact 3 - Ingredient labels are often incorrect.

In a study of 52 brands of mass produced dog and cat food the findings found that only 40% contained protein sources that were not listed on the ingredient list one of which the protein source couldn't be identified.

Fact 4 - You can feed your Cat or Dog Human food (with an exception to some foods)

You can feed your pet human food as long as it contains necessary vitamins and minerals for optimal health. However it is important to stick to certain food groups which will improve your pets health significantly.

Proteins - Turkey breast, pork shoulder, beef and white fish.

Brassica vegetables- Broccoli, brussel sprouts, cauliflower, kale

Other vegetables - Zucchini, squash, pumpkin, green beans, carrot.

All in moderation
